First time jobless claims down

More than 350,000 Americans filed for unemployment insurance benefits for the first time during the week ended March 1, according to the U.S. Department of Labor.

That’s a decrease of 24,000 from the previous week’s revised figure of 375,000. The 4-week moving average was 359,500, a decrease of 1,500 from the previous week.
